Most players jump into a game with no plan. They think a ‘strategy’ is just picking a number and hoping. That is not a strategy. That is a donation. From what I’ve seen, the best approach is a simple one. I use a flat betting system. I pick an outside bet, like red or black, or even money. I bet the same amount every spin. No Martingale. No Fibonacci. Just consistent, small bets.
Why? Because the house edge is fixed. You cannot beat the math. But you can beat the casino’s loyalty system. If you play a smart, low-variance game, you survive longer. You earn more loyalty points. You convert those points into cash or free spins. That is where the real value is. The casinos want you to play fast and lose big. Is there a guaranteed winning roulette betting strategy?
No. There is no such thing. Anyone who tells you otherwise is selling something. The house always has an edge. The only way to ‘win’ is to play on sites with good cashback and loyalty programs. That is my strategy.
What is the best bet for a roulette betting strategy UK 2026 best tips and sites?
For me, it is outside bets. Red/Black, Odd/Even, High/Low. They pay 1:1 and have a low house edge (2.7% on European roulette). It is boring, but it keeps your bankroll alive long enough to earn points.
